The phrase "Aion 3.9 client verified" typically refers to the process of setting up or troubleshooting a specific version (3.9) of the Aion MMORPG client, often for use on private servers. In this context, "verified" usually means the client files have been checked for integrity, compatibility, and the presence of necessary launchers or patches to connect to a specific server. Understanding the Aion 3.9 Client Verification Process

is a popular "classic" version of the game, favored by many players for its balance and nostalgia. Ensuring a "verified" client is essential for a stable gaming experience without crashes or "Send Log" errors.

File Integrity: The core of a verified client is the Data and L10N folders. Verification involves ensuring that no files are missing or corrupted, which can happen during large downloads. Client scanning : The game client is scanned

Version Matching: The client version must exactly match the server version. Even a minor discrepancy in the version.ini file can prevent the client from being recognized as "verified" by the server launcher.

The Launcher's Role: Most private servers provide a custom launcher. This tool performs a checksum of your local files against the server's master files—this is the literal "verification" step.

Clean Installation: To achieve a verified status, it is often recommended to start with a clean retail Aion folder and then apply the specific 3.9 patches, rather than mixing files from different versions. Common Troubleshooting Steps

If your client is not being verified or shows errors, follow these standard procedures:

Run as Administrator: Ensure the launcher has permission to read and write to the game directory.

Antivirus Exceptions: Security software often flags custom .dll files (like d3d9.dll used for shaders or fixes) as false positives, preventing verification.

Check the Bin32/Bin64 Folders: Aion 3.9 typically runs on a 32-bit engine. Ensure your launcher is pointing to the correct executable within the Bin32 folder.

Re-apply the Patch: If verification fails, deleting the bin folder and allowing the launcher to re-download it is the fastest fix.

How to Install the Verified Client

Once you have your verified folder, installation is drag-and-drop (no registry edits required for most modern 3.9 servers).

  1. Extract the .7z or .rar file to C:\Games\Aion39 (Avoid Program Files to prevent permission issues).
  2. Navigate to the server’s website and download their specific Server Launcher (Usually a 1MB .exe).
  3. Place the launcher inside your verified client folder.
  4. Right-click the launcher -> Properties -> Compatibility -> Run as Administrator.
  5. Launch. The tool will check your aion.bin file. If it says "Client verified OK," you are ready to play.
